AUDIO / VISUAL: AUDIO AND VISUAL SYSTEM (w/ Navigation System): B15C3: Speaker Output Short
B15C3 - Speaker Output Short
DESCRIPTION
This DTC is stored when a malfunction occurs in the speakers.
* *1: w/ Manual (SOS) Switch
WIRING DIAGRAM
INSPECTION PROCEDURE
PROCEDURE
1. INSPECT STEREO COMPONENT AMPLIFIER ASSEMBLY
(a) Disconnect stereo component amplifier connectors P44 and P28.
(b) Clear the DTCs and recheck for DTCs.
(c) Check if DTC B15C3 is output.
OK:
DTC B15C3 is not output.
NG -- REPLACE STEREO COMPONENT AMPLIFIER ASSEMBLY Removal
OK -- Continue to next step.
2. CHECK OPERATION
(a) Reconnect stereo component amplifier connector P28.
(b) Check if DTC B15C3 is output.
OK:
DTC B15C3 is not output.
NG -- CHECK HARNESS AND CONNECTOR
OK -- Continue to next step.
